Job Description
The Executive Protection Agent's mission is to protect all people, information and property assigned, while delivering on high end customer service. EP Agents represent the front line of our security services. In this role EP Agents can expect to be working in demanding and fast paced and often high stress environments. Additionally EP Agents may be required to work with a firearm.
JOB D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
Perform mobile and static protection solo or while working as part of a larger team
Perform security driver duties in support of the Client
Conduct advance work and report on gathered intelligence
Liaise with local authorities when applicable emergency situations arise
Maintain high levels of discretion, confidentiality, and professionalism
Participate in company-provided training as well as continue their own professional development, advancing both hard and soft skills relevant to the position
Delivering high-end customer service
Responding to emergencies
Deterring and preventing crime
Performing ingress/ egress control procedures
Investigating incidents
Completing daily logs and incident reports
Conducting regular walking or vehicle patrols
Building and maintaining a professional rapport with clients, guests and co-workers
De-escalating conflicts
Detaining suspects
Monitoring CCTV cameras
Performing other related duties as assigned
Ensuring safety of principal and family members
Conducting risk assessment and planning to minimize threats
Establishing and maintaining secure environments
Maintaining the security of the household and vehicles
Using physical intervention as necessary
Responding to medical emergencies
Skills/Qualifications
Possess at least one of the following experience criteria:
4+ years of combat military / law enforcement / armed security experience
Successful completion of a state or federal certified law enforcement training academy or recognized Executive Protection school
Experience in executive protection, law enforcement, military, or armed security preferred
Strong decision-making and problem-solving skills
Basic computer and phone skills (Email, Microsoft Office, Signal, WhatsApp, Life 360, etc.)
Must be able to obtain and maintain Ohio Private Security / OPOTA firearms certification (as required for armed duties)
Conduct surveillance activities in support of protective operations
Must be legally eligible to carry a firearm in the state of Ohio
Excellent written and oral communication skills
Proficient time management skills
Reliable transportation
Excellent de-escalation skill
Extensive use of force knowledge
